How to get to and around Koga
The nearest airport is in Fukuoka Airport (FUK), located 10.1 mi (16.3 km) from the city center. If you can't find a flight that works for your travel itinerary, you could book a flight to Kitakyushu Airport (KKJ), which is 32.1 mi (51.6 km) away.
If you prefer to travel by train, Koga Station, Chidori Station and Shishibu Station are the main stations that serve the city.
